I have a small potted redwood tree, approx. 3-4 feet that I need to get rid of. What can I do with it?


Question:No one I know wants it. Is there a charity I can give it to? It's a healthy tree. I'm moving and can't take it with me.

Answers:
Give it away on www.freecycle.org. You can also give away other items you don't want to move but would prefer not to put out in the trash.


sell it or give it away on craigslist. you can also try putting it on your curb where you put your trash so that someone driving by can pick it up.
have you tried your local freecycle? www.freecycle.org (on yahoo groups also but easier to get your local from the website). Otherwise the local Salvation Army might take it-you never know!
